How much do structure material eng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for structure material engineer in the United States is $100,738.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$80,000.00 and $116,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Position Overview


Kratos Industries is seeking an experienced Manufacturing Engineer to lead BOM validation, kit readiness, and production process definition within our advanced electrical equipment manufacturing operations.


This role will focus on ensuring engineering output is accurate, complete, and executable in production, with primary responsibility for, but not limited to:


BOM validation and alignment (Engineering to ERP(JobBoss) to physical build)

Kit readiness and verification processes

Production process definition and build sequence

Work instruction development

Engineering-to-production integration

Material and pick list accuracy tied to production sequence

In-process issue resolution tied to design or BOM gaps


We are specifically seeking a Manufacturing Engineer who has worked directly in production environments, not solely supporting design, but ensuring product is buildable, repeatable, and aligned to real assembly conditions.


Key Responsibilities


BOM Validation & Material Alignment

Validate BOMs at job release to ensure alignment between engineering models, JobBoss, and physical build requirements

Identify and resolve alternates, gaps, and inconsistencies prior to kit release

Partner with Supply Chain and Logistics to ensure pick lists reflect true production needs

Reduce material-related disruptions during assembly builds

Kit Readiness & production Start Stability

Support development and enforcement of formal kit verification processes

Ensure kits are complete, accurate, and build-ready prior to release

Drive improvements in clean start performance across all production lines


Production Process Definition

Define how products are built at the line level, including build sequence and key constraints

Ensure processes reflect actual production conditions and flow

Partner with leadership to align process with layout and material presentation

Work Instructions & Process Documentation

Develop clear, operator-focused work instructions tied to validated BOMs and actual build flow

Prioritize critical-to-quality steps and known failure points

Support transition from tacit knowledge to structured, repeatable processes


Production Support & Issue Resolution

Act as first-line engineering support for assembly-related issues

Participate in Tier 2 escalation and drive closure of BOM, material, and process-related problems

Work directly with technicians and leaders to resolve build issues in real time


Continuous Improvement & Cross-Functional Alignment

Identify gaps between engineering output and production execution

Improve BOM structure, material flow clarity, and process definition

Partner with Industrial Engineering, Quality, and Supply Chain to improve first-pass yield and reduce rework
